He said officials toured neighborhoods Sunday to survey the damage.Īerial view of damaged homes a day after a tornado hit Madison, Tennessee. Many homes throughout the Clarksville area are also without power, which could take weeks to fully restore, Clarksville Mayor Joe Pitts told reporters Sunday. When questioned about tornado sirens not going off prior to the storm, Edwards said, “he couldn’t respond as to why the warning sirens didn’t go off until after the fact.” O’Connell said the city has been in touch with the Tennessee Emergency Management Agency and will be coordinating with the Federal Emergency Management Agency. Some of the worst hit areas could take days to get power back, they said. Responders said 22 structures collapsed as a result of the storms, along with countless others damaged, O’Connell said.Ī spokesperson for Nashville Electric Service said crews have restored 18,000 customers, but substations in Hendersonville and North Nashville suffered significant damage and there is no estimated restoration time. Nashville Electric Service is working to restore power, Nashville Mayor Freddie O’Connell told reporters Sunday. The Tennessee Emergency Management Agency said in Sumner County, two water utilities were running on generator power. ![]() Mark Zaleski/APĪs of Sunday afternoon, there were more than 35,000 reports of power outages across the state, according to the monitoring website. 10, 2023, Clarksville, Tennessee, where residents and emergency workers are continuing the cleanup from severe weekend storms. Montgomery officials reported 62 patients were treated at medical facilities.Ī truck lies on its side beside damaged homes on Sunday, Dec. There are currently 25 displaced people at shelters and the number is expected to increase, he added. An EF2 tornado hit Madison and nearby Hendersonville with peak winds of 125 mph, according to a preliminary survey by the weather service.įirst responders responded to more than 400 calls overnight, Nashville Fire Chief William Swann said. The tornado that devastated Clarksville over an 11-mile path was of EF3 intensity with peak winds of 150 mph, the National Weather Service in Nashville said Sunday in a storm survey.Īnother three people were confirmed dead in Madison, Tennessee, just north of Nashville, emergency management officials said Saturday night. Tennessee officials are assessing the damage after tornadoes and strong thunderstorms roared across the state Saturday, leaving at least six people dead, more than 50 injured, multiple buildings destroyed and power outages.Īt least three people died, including a child, after a tornado struck the Clarksville area of Montgomery County in northern Tennessee, officials said Saturday night. ![]() Meta then delivers individualised ads from us on Facebook or on Instagram that are tailored to your needs. This causes Vic to commit one more murder as he strangles Melinda to death at the end. She isn't going to cover for him like she does in the movie. Vic doesn't love Melinda, and he isn't killing these men "for her." Vic lives his life in emasculation, and after he realizes Melinda knows what he has done, he takes one last drastic measure. This leads to a very different ending in the Deep Water book. Vic considers his wife to be selfish and spoiled, and who only seeks attention in any way possible. While Melinda often makes sexual advances on Vic, often in a dominatrix fashion, that is nonexistent in the book. However, in the book, they actively despise each other. That is because the two work to keep their family intact in both, but in the movie, they seem to actually somewhat like each other and Vic loves Melinda. In the novel, the murders and dishonesty don't result in a better relationship between Vic and Melinda. It had most recently been slated to open on Jan. “Deep Water” was originally set up at 20th Century Fox before the Disney-Fox merger. ![]() ![]() Similar to the VGA option, you can use an RCA-to-3.5mm jack cable or an Xbox HDMI audio adapter to extract the audio signal and connect it to external speakers or headphones. To get audio while using a DVI cable, you will need to connect an additional audio cable. It’s important to note that DVI cables only transmit video signals and do not carry audio. Select the appropriate input source on your display to view the Xbox screen.After ensuring that the connections are secure, power on your Xbox console and the display.Plug the other end of the DVI cable into the DVI port on your Xbox console.Connect one end of the DVI cable to the DVI port on your display.Obtain a DVI cable compatible with your Xbox console.This method is suitable if your TV, monitor, or projector has a DVI input port.įollow these steps to set up your Xbox with a DVI cable: Using a high-quality cable is crucial to avoid image distortion or signal degradation.Īnother option for connecting your Xbox console to a display without HDMI is by using a DVI (Digital Visual Interface) cable. Ensure that the VGA cable you choose is specifically designed for the Xbox console and supports the appropriate resolution. However, keep in mind that not all VGA cables are created equal. This makes it an excellent choice for gamers who want a better visual experience without HDMI. With the VGA option, you can achieve a maximum resolution of 1920×1080 (1080p) depending on your monitor’s capabilities. Depending on your Xbox model, you can use an RCA-to-3.5mm jack cable or an Xbox HDMI audio adapter to extract the audio signal and connect it to external speakers or headphones. To transmit audio, you will need to connect an additional audio cable. It’s important to note that a VGA cable transmits video signals only. On your display, select the VGA input source to see the Xbox screen.Once everything is connected, turn on your Xbox console and the display.Plug the other end of the VGA cable into the VGA port on your Xbox console.Connect one end of the VGA cable to the VGA port on your display.Obtain a VGA cable that is compatible with your Xbox console.Here’s how you can connect your Xbox console to a VGA display: This option provides a higher resolution compared to composite AV cables, allowing for a better gaming experience. If you have a computer monitor or a projector that supports VGA input, you can connect your Xbox to it using a VGA cable. Check the specific requirements of your Xbox model to ensure compatibility. Keep in mind that some Xbox consoles may require an AV cable adapter to connect the composite AV cable. However, this option is still a viable choice if you’re using an older TV without HDMI capability or if you’re looking for a quick and inexpensive solution. The maximum resolution supported by this method is 480i, which is standard definition. Please note that while the composite AV cable will allow you to play your Xbox games, the image quality will not be as sharp as HDMI. Using your TV’s remote, select the correct input source (e.g., AV, Video, or Composite) to display the Xbox screen.Plug the other end of the composite AV cable into the AV port on your Xbox console.Connect the red and white connectors to the corresponding audio inputs on your TV.Connect the yellow connector to the yellow composite video input on your TV. ![]() Locate the composite AV cable that came with your Xbox. They learn and comprehend much better through back-and-forth conversation than if someone simply lectures at them. As a result, they may come across as poor listeners – unless spoken to or interacted with in an actionable way. Hand gestures, vivid facial expressions, and constant movement are a regular practice in social situations. When speaking to a group or even to one person, the Kinesthetic Learner is likely to very emphatic in their motions. This movement is part of the process of memorization and is absolutely essential in their learning process. Always quick to try a new approach or test out a theory, they like to manipulate and modify – and their ability to remember the modification steps afterward is strikingly impressive. They anxiously await the opportunity to put their skills to real-life use, and manage to progress rapidly from active failures or setbacks. These learners want to act and put their knowledge into play, not simply sit back and listen.īeing idle for long periods of time often takes away from what a Kinesthetic Learner remembers and comprehends from a lesson or activity. ![]() Kinesthetic Learners often struggle with visual and auditory-only presentations such as film clips, speakers, and podcasts, because there is no direct interaction between them and the person providing the information. Even when deeply engaged in a session, they’ll often twitch their leg or find some other way to move – typically in a repetitive motion. The Kinesthetic Learner isn’t one to sit still for long periods of time. When learning a new language, the kinesthetic learner progresses most efficiently through immersion and one-on-one engagement. They need physical involvement to optimize their understanding and takeaway from a lesson or activity. ![]() Kinesthetic Learners (Also see Auditory & Visual learner)įormally known as Kinesthetic Modality, the Kinesthetic Learner is one who learns by doing, by placing themselves directly in the action. |
